Pachter Predicts Sixth Month Of Negative Sales For Wii



Michael Pachter from industry analyst, Wedbush Morgan has commented Nintendo will September's sales for the Wii enter its sixth negative month in a row:
“With the core PS3 and Xbox 360 models priced only USD 50 higher than the Wii, we expect year-over-year sales of Wii hardware to continue their annual declines until the company either changes its bundle or lowers price."

“Wii unit sales are 50 percent below last year’s level over the last five months, and we think that September sales will repeat the pattern.”
